Freed Belarusian Dissident Describes Torture, Calls for Release of Political Prisoners

Freed Belarusian Dissident Describes Torture, Calls for Release of Political Prisoners

News EditorBy News EditorJune 26, 2025 World 5 Mins Read

Belarusian dissident Siarhei Tsikhanouski has been released after spending more than five years as a political prisoner. His release marks a significant moment not just for him but also for many others who remain incarcerated in Belarusian prisons. After being freed, Tsikhanouski called for international intervention to support the release of remaining political prisoners, highlighting the harsh realities of human rights violations in Belarus.

Tsikhanouski Chronicles Harrowing Experience in Detention

In a visceral video message shared at the United Nations Human Rights Council, Siarhei Tsikhanouski unveiled the details of his torturous experience during his incarceration. He described conditions that involved solitary confinement and lack of communication, stating, “I was tortured… held in solitary confinement… I didn’t receive a single letter.” His heart-wrenching accounts serve as a stark reminder of the brutal treatment of political prisoners in Belarus.

Tsikhanouski articulated his despair, claiming that the regime filled his ears with lies, attempting to convince him he had been forgotten. His assertions underscore that what takes place in Belarusian prisons is not merely law enforcement but rather systematic abuse and cruelty. The situation he describes raises urgent questions about the rule of law and human rights within Belarus.

The poignant details shared by Tsikhanouski highlight both the psychological and physical toll of imprisonment, as he revealed a dramatic loss of weight—over 41% during his confinement. He went from 298 pounds down to just 174 upon release, a stark representation of the dehumanizing conditions he endured.

The Role of the International Community

Tsikhanouski credited his release to the efforts of the international community, particularly pointing to actions taken during the Trump administration. In a significant meeting with Belarusian President Alexander Lukashenko, U.S. Special Envoy on Ukraine and Russia, Gen. Keith Kellogg, played a crucial role in mediating the release of Tsikhanouski along with 13 other political prisoners.

The Belarusian dissident acknowledged the “international solidarity” that contributed to his freedom, emphasizing that he would not be alive today without that support. His remarks serve to highlight the impact that global diplomatic efforts can have on individual lives, particularly in oppressive regimes. This collaborative pressure underlines the need for continued international engagement regarding Belarus and similar governance challenges worldwide.

Impact of Tsikhanouski’s Release on Belarusian Politics

Tsikhanouski’s release is poised to influence the broader political landscape within Belarus significantly. While he was reunited with his wife, Sviatlana Tsikhanouskaya, a prominent opposition leader who some countries recognize as the legitimate president of Belarus, the stark reality remains that over 1,150 political prisoners still languish behind bars.

Tsikhanouskaya’s immediate reactions echoed hope intertwined with anger towards the regime. She stated on social media, “My husband is free! It’s hard to describe the joy in my heart… 1,150 political prisoners remain behind bars. All must be released.” Her determination amplifies the urgency for political change and reform in Belarus, reinforcing that their fight is far from over.

Remaining Challenges for Political Prisoners

The situation for political prisoners in Belarus took a drastic turn for the worse since January 2025, according to the U.N. Special Rapporteur on Human Rights in Belarus, Nils Muižnieks. He pointed out that authorities have been abusing laws that constrain freedoms, including prohibiting insults against the president and public officials. This draconian legislation translates into widespread abuses, further complicating the landscape for human rights.

Muižnieks discussed how many imprisoned individuals, including opposition leaders and environmental activists, are unjustly detained in deplorable conditions. His recent statements lend urgency to Tsikhanouski’s pleas, pushing for international accountability and intervention—an echo of the plight felt by many oppositional figures in Belarus.

Human Rights Advocacy and Future Actions

Following Tsikhanouski’s release and his powerful statement at the U.N., human rights advocates have rallied to support the remaining political prisoners in Belarus. Hillel Neuer, Executive Director of U.N. Watch, emphasized that Tsikhanouski represents courage and hope in the face of governmental repression. He highlighted the need for voices like Tsikhanouski’s to be heard by international leaders, as they continue to confront and challenge systemic abuses.

The urgency for a sustained international response to the conditions within Belarus cannot be overstated. Advocates urge the U.N. and world governments to maintain pressure on the Belarusian regime, not only to secure the release of remaining prisoners but also to push for broader reforms that protect human rights and promote freedom.
